Just ordered mine from omnimodels on ebay 119 with free shipping. I can't wait to get it. I haven't ordered the shocks yet but for those of you that don't know these are the shocks that Billy told me were approved Tamiya 53619 or Tamiya 50746.
Re: New Spec Class
Don't get the 53619, that shock won't work so well on the mini's. Get the 50746, they come in pairs so you need 2. The best thing you can get for the car is bearings so do those first if it's between shocks or bearings.
Welcome to the class, your gonna have fun with this car!
